Echinoderms are a group of invertebrate animals that live in the sea. There are about 6,000 kinds of echinoderms, with the main kinds being sea stars, brittle stars, sea urchins, and sea cucumbers. Readers will learn about the life cycle of echinoderms, how they eat and defend themselves, and much more. They'll even get an up-close look at sand dollars and crown-of-thorns sea stars.
